Brits renovating their home with new kitchen tiling may wish to think about fitting neon lights.
This is because designer at NoChintz Katie Crolla claimed this option will be a big hit in 2012.
She explained this can look good in any area of the home and there are also similar considerations for those who find this too adventurous for their tastes.
Accents of these colours can be achieved through certain wallpapers, in addition to being complemented by accessories and furniture.
"Kitsch, neon lighting used in the correct way gives a tongue-in-cheek, modern effect," the expert commented.
If taking this advice, homeowners may also wish to bear in mind the impact it may have on security light fixtures, as spokeswoman for Light IQ Natalie Timmerman said ambient and deterrent lights should not detract from one another.
"Dark grey and brown finishes on cabinet doors and work surfaces, combined with brushed stainless steel work surfaces" were also noted as being in vogue by Ms Crolla.
